Hi there, hoping you can help, i am trying to find out what the requirements are to import a vintage vehicle into NZ. Looking at importing a 1930 something Austin 7 which has been in my husbands family since new in the UK. Does this come under the SIV requirements?

Vehicles over 20 years old are exempt from the current frontal impact, emissions, and stability control requirements (so SIV exemption not required).
The standards a vehicle of 1930's era will be general wof standards, and can be physically inspected once here. The main thing with an older vehicle is rust/ corrosion or any repairs that have been carried out, may need to be repair certified upon entry to NZ.
